Onboarding note for support: the Tidewhistle notification service is extremely chatty, so we sample its logs at 5% by default. If a customer reports missing events, you can temporarily raise the sample rate for their tenant through the Driftbox log-control API rather than filing an infra ticket. Changes auto-revert after two hours. All log-control requests must be authenticated; for support-tier access, use the key below.

service key, fawip-bajef: kto11_Qt5wZK9vdNC

Subject: Quickstore 4.2 — bloom filter now fronts the KV layer

Plugin authors: starting with this release, Quickstore places a bloom filter ahead of the key-value store. Negative lookups return faster; false positives fall through safely. No API changes are required on your side. Verify your plugin against the staging build referenced below.

session token of fahif-tadup = htk3_9c7

# PickPath optimizer settings
# PickPath computes optimal pick routes for the Darvey warehouse floor.
# Tuning weights below affect aisle-crossing penalties and batch sizes;
# change them only after running the simulation suite, as bad weights
# can double picker walk time. The optimizer reads live bin locations
# from the inventory database, reached via the connection string below.

primary connection of yagag-kaguf = mssql://praox_svc:wUPY5WS@db-c12a.sivrelio.corp:5432/gordor